1. Roomba i7+

The Roomba I7+ is our most advanced robot vacuum. It was able to remove 82% of flour, kitty litter, and pet hair and can be used with the Roomba app to map, scheduling and no-go zones. It features technology to avoid obstacles that can detect everyday objects, such as socks and cables, and moves around them. It is also always learning and improving which makes it the most intelligent vacuum we've ever seen. It's so confident in its ability to avoid pet waste that it has an "Pet Owner Official Promise" in which iRobot will replace your Roomba i7and if it fails to correctly avoid solid pet waste.

The i7+ has the similar circular design of other Roomba models, but with an oblong black divot in the center, which houses the navigation camera. The i7's base+ is slightly taller than that of previous Roomba models as it houses the self-emptying bin. The start button features an LED ring that lights white while cleaning, red when charging and blue when connected to Wi-Fi.

We tested the i7+ on various flooring types, including low-pile carpet and it performed well across all types of flooring. It was less likely to become stuck than the previous models, and it also picked up pet fur (and the clumps that come with it) easily. The i7+ comes with a Clean Base power cord, two bags for disposal and a virtual wall and an additional filter.

When we tested the i7+'s sound level in both quiet and high modes, it registered 77 decibels. This is louder than the majority of conversations but not as loud as other auto vacuums we've tried. We also tested the suction of the i7+ in both modes and found that it sucked up a significant amount of dirt, even on hardwood floors.

2. Eufy RoboVac G30 Edge

The G30 Edge, the latest model in eufy’s RoboVac range is a budget-friendly version of this bestselling line. It features the company's innovative navigation 2.0 technology and BoostIQ to clean pet hair more powerfully. You can also create boundary strips to keep the vacuum from areas that you don't want to clean, such as a mess of toys for kids or a bundle behind your television.

Eufy robots are known for their refined appearance, and this one is no different. The black plastic with a brushed finish around the dustbin and at the bottom of the robot, which complements its bronze concentric circles that are on the top. The vacuum also has three physical buttons: a Play/Pause Button which resembles a CD player button as well as a Recharge button that allows you to dock the G30 Edge and a Spot Clean button. Above them is a Wi-Fi status indicator.

As with the other vacuums in our comparison like all of the other vacuums in our comparison, the G30 Edge can be controlled remotely from your phone. The app shows a map of your house so you can track the robot. A "Find My Bot" feature lets you send the robot an alert that causes it to play an intense tune until it is found. This is useful when you're lost of it while cleaning or if you can't reach the controls to locate it when it's stuck under something.

The G30 Edge's battery can last approximately 100 minutes. It comes with anti-drop sensors that keep it from falling down stairs or taking steep drops, and it will return to its charging base when its battery gets depleted. You can get a replacement for the battery for around $30.

4. Deebot T10 Omni

The Deebot T10 Omni is one of the most advanced robot vacuums on the market with a remarkable vacuuming performance and the ability to add mopheads for the scrubbing. It's also fairly quiet, with a sound level of just 66 decibels. Its incredible vacuuming capabilities and flexible app-based control make it an ideal option for homes with pets.

The T10 is ECOVACSThe second-generation Deebot vacuum cleaner, and includes a variety of new features. It uses an RGB sensor and LiDAR camera for creating 3-D and 2-D maps of your house, which helps it avoid obstacles and navigate. It also can recognize furniture and other objects to adjust cleaning modes automatically. It also comes with a built-in voice assistant called YIKO that can respond to a variety of commands.

Its all-in-one OMNI Station can be used as a charging base as well as a water tank, dustbin, and mop pad dispenser. The OMNI Station is able to detect and automatically replenish mop pads if they're empty. It also automatically empty the dustbin into a 3L disposable bag that holds up to 60 days of dust. It also makes use of heat to dry the mop pads following each use, preventing the development of odors and bacteria.

The T10 features a suction power of 5,000pa, which allows it to remove pet hair with ease. It also comes with a floating main brush that's designed to prevent carpet fibers from being pulled up in the process. I tried out the T10's pet hair-cleaning capabilities by running it over an area rug covered with hair from dogs. It was able to eliminate the majority of hair from the fibers in two cleaning cycles.
